Проход по ссылкам навигацииГлавная : Статьи :

Программируемый выключатель света с дистанционным управлением

Программируемый выключатель света с дистанционным управлением

Стереоусилитель на tda2822m

Стереоусилитель на tda2822m В этой Розетка с дистанционным управлением купить статье речь пойдет о Фото реле vito phs01 схема подключения программируемом выключателе Стереоусилитель на tda2822m света с дистанционным LM723 блок питания управлением.

Функционал:
Источники электропитания Возможность управлять Стереоусилитель на tda2822m выключателем любым Розетка с дистанционным управлением купить бытовым ИК пультом Фото реле vito phs01 схема подключения управления.
Программировать выключатель на Стереоусилитель на tda2822m любую кнопку бытового ИК LM723 блок питания пульта управления.
Включать/выключать Стереоусилитель на tda2822m свет, Источники электропитания как от клавиши выключателя, так Стереоусилитель на tda2822m и Стереоусилитель на tda2822m с пульта, Розетка с дистанционным управлением купить не зависимо друг от Фото реле vito phs01 схема подключения друга.

Схема Стереоусилитель на tda2822m и комплектующие:
Стереоусилитель на tda2822m


Для LM723 блок питания сборки прототипа Источники электропитания использовал следующие Стереоусилитель на tda2822m компоненты:
- Розетка с дистанционным управлением купить Контроллер Carduino Nano Фото реле vito phs01 схема подключения V.7
- Relay Стереоусилитель на tda2822m Module
- ИК приемник LM723 блок питания TSOP
- Макетная Стереоусилитель на tda2822m плата
Источники электропитания - Звуковой излучатель

Фотография компонентов:
Стереоусилитель на tda2822m


Стереоусилитель на tda2822m Описание Стереоусилитель на tda2822m работы с Розетка с дистанционным управлением купить выключателем

Сначала добавляем в Фото реле vito phs01 схема подключения память выключателя Стереоусилитель на tda2822m код кнопки пульта LM723 блок питания управления. Для Источники электропитания этого мы Стереоусилитель на tda2822m берем наиболее Розетка с дистанционным управлением купить подходящий нам пульт Фото реле vito phs01 схема подключения управления (пульт от кондициоСтереоусилитель на tda2822m нера не подойдет) и выбираем LM723 блок питания на нем свободную Стереоусилитель на tda2822m кнопку, Источники электропитания которой Вы никогда не пользуетесь Стереоусилитель на tda2822m (обычно Стереоусилитель на tda2822m это цветные Розетка с дистанционным управлением купить кнопки телетекста). Входим в Фото реле vito phs01 схема подключения режим программирования Стереоусилитель на tda2822m выключателя, для этого LM723 блок питания нужно Источники электропитания нажать на клавишу Стереоусилитель на tda2822m вкл/выкл и Розетка с дистанционным управлением купить подержать 5 секунд, Фото реле vito phs01 схема подключения раздастся длинный звуковой сигнал Стереоусилитель на tda2822m «Бип», после этого остается LM723 блок питания нажать ранее выбранную Стереоусилитель на tda2822m кнопку Источники электропитания пульта и ваш выключатель готов Стереоусилитель на tda2822m к Стереоусилитель на tda2822m работе. Теперь Розетка с дистанционным управлением купить выключатель света будет понимать Фото реле vito phs01 схема подключения добавленную в Стереоусилитель на tda2822m него команду Вашего LM723 блок питания ИК пульта. Источники электропитания Код кнопки Стереоусилитель на tda2822m сохраняется в Розетка с дистанционным управлением купить энергонезависимой памяти контроллера Фото реле vito phs01 схема подключения и будет храниться в Стереоусилитель на tda2822m памяти даже после отключения LM723 блок питания питания схемы.

Видео Стереоусилитель на tda2822m работы Источники электропитания выключателя:


Код для контроллера Arduino:
Стереоусилитель на tda2822m #include <IRremote.h>   
Розетка с дистанционным управлением купить #include <avr/delay.h> 
#include <EEPROM.h> 
Стереоусилитель на tda2822m #define button 7 
LM723 блок питания #define speaker Источники электропитания 11 
#define Стереоусилитель на tda2822m lamp 6 

Розетка с дистанционным управлением купить IRrecv irrecv(2);  //вход Фото реле vito phs01 схема подключения для ик приемника 
decode_Стереоусилитель на tda2822m results results;   
unsigned long ir_command; 
LM723 блок питания uint8_t swt, count, Стереоусилитель на tda2822m state Источники электропитания = 0;  //статус лампочки 
    
void Стереоусилитель на tda2822m setup()   
Стереоусилитель на tda2822m {   
  pinMode(speaker, Розетка с дистанционным управлением купить OUTPUT);//громкоговоритель 
  pinMode(button, INPUT);Фото реле vito phs01 схема подключения //вход для Стереоусилитель на tda2822m кнопки 
  digitalWrite(button,HIGH);LM723 блок питания //включить подтяжку 
  Источники электропитания pinMode(lamp, OUTPUT);Стереоусилитель на tda2822m //лампочка 
  irrecv.Розетка с дистанционным управлением купить enableIRIn(); // включить Фото реле vito phs01 схема подключения приемник   
}   
    
void loop()  
Стереоусилитель на tda2822m {   
 swt=digitalRead(button); 
 count=0;  
 while(swt==0) 
   LM723 блок питания { 
    if(count>30) 
     {  
       Стереоусилитель на tda2822m beep(100,Источники электропитания 400); 
       for(unsigned long i=0; i<2000000; Стереоусилитель на tda2822m i++) 
       Стереоусилитель на tda2822m { 
         if Розетка с дистанционным управлением купить (irrecv.decode(&results))   
          {   
            SaveEEPROM(results.Фото реле vito phs01 схема подключения value);   
            irrecv.Стереоусилитель на tda2822m resume();            
            break;             
          LM723 блок питания } 
        }  
       beep(30,Источники электропитания 900);   
       break;  
      Стереоусилитель на tda2822m } 
    count++;   
    Розетка с дистанционным управлением купить swt=digitalRead(button);   
    _delay_ms(100);  
   } 
   
 Фото реле vito phs01 схема подключения ir_command=LoadEEPROM(); 
    if (irrecv.decode(&results)) 
    Стереоусилитель на tda2822m {     
      if(ir_command==results.value)  
        { 
          LM723 блок питания state=~state;  
          digitalWrite(lamp, state); 
          Стереоусилитель на tda2822m beep(10,Источники электропитания 300);  
          _delay_ms(700);  
        Стереоусилитель на tda2822m }             
     irrecv.resume();          
    } Стереоусилитель на tda2822m else  if(count>1)       
             Розетка с дистанционным управлением купить {  
               state=~state; 
               digitalWrite(lamp, state);  
               Фото реле vito phs01 схема подключения beep(10,500); 
               Стереоусилитель на tda2822m _delay_ms(100); 
             }         
} 

LM723 блок питания void SaveEEPROM(unsigned Источники электропитания long ir_code) 
Стереоусилитель на tda2822m { 
  EEPROM.Розетка с дистанционным управлением купить write(0, ir_code & Фото реле vito phs01 схема подключения 0xFF); 
  EEPROM.write(1, (ir_code Стереоусилитель на tda2822m & 0xFF00) >> 8); 
  LM723 блок питания EEPROM.write(2, (ir_code Стереоусилитель на tda2822m & Источники электропитания 0xFF0000) >> 16); 
  EEPROM.write(3, Стереоусилитель на tda2822m (ir_code Стереоусилитель на tda2822m & 0xFF000000) >> 24); 
} 

unsigned Фото реле vito phs01 схема подключения long LoadEEPROM()  
Стереоусилитель на tda2822m { 
  byte val LM723 блок питания = EEPROM.Источники электропитания read(3);  
  unsigned Стереоусилитель на tda2822m long ir_code=Розетка с дистанционным управлением купить val; 
      val = EEPROM.Фото реле vito phs01 схема подключения read(2); 
                ir_code= (ir_code << Стереоусилитель на tda2822m 8) | val; 
      val LM723 блок питания = EEPROM.read(1); 
                Стереоусилитель на tda2822m ir_code= Источники электропитания (ir_code << 8) | Стереоусилитель на tda2822m val; 
      val Стереоусилитель на tda2822m = EEPROM.Розетка с дистанционным управлением купить read(0); 
                ir_code= (ir_code << Фото реле vito phs01 схема подключения 8) | Стереоусилитель на tda2822m val; 
  return ir_code; 
LM723 блок питания } 

void Источники электропитания beep(byte dur, Стереоусилитель на tda2822m word frq) 
Розетка с дистанционным управлением купить { 
  dur=(1000/frq)*dur; 
  for(byte Фото реле vito phs01 схема подключения i=0; i<dur; i++) 
  { 
   Стереоусилитель на tda2822m digitalWrite(speaker, HIGH);  
   _delay_us(frq);  
   digitalWrite(speaker, LM723 блок питания LOW); 
   _delay_us(frq); 
  Стереоусилитель на tda2822m }  
} 


Источники электропитания Для компиляции кода нужно добавить Стереоусилитель на tda2822m библиотеку Стереоусилитель на tda2822m IRemote - Розетка с дистанционным управлением купить Вы не можете скачивать Фото реле vito phs01 схема подключения файлы с Стереоусилитель на tda2822m нашего сервера
Библиотека LM723 блок питания отличается от Источники электропитания оригинальной, так Стереоусилитель на tda2822m как я Розетка с дистанционным управлением купить добавил к ней Фото реле vito phs01 схема подключения еще несколько протоколов, в Стереоусилитель на tda2822m том числе и новый LM723 блок питания протокол LED телевизоров Стереоусилитель на tda2822m Samsung

Источники электропитания После отладки устройства на arduino, Стереоусилитель на tda2822m нарисовал Стереоусилитель на tda2822m окончательную схему Розетка с дистанционным управлением купить будущего выключателя. Так как Фото реле vito phs01 схема подключения я уже Стереоусилитель на tda2822m писал ранее, что LM723 блок питания Arduino это Источники электропитания удобное средство Стереоусилитель на tda2822m для отладкРозетка с дистанционным управлением купить и и написания кода, Фото реле vito phs01 схема подключения но для окончательной схемы Стереоусилитель на tda2822m он не подойдет.

Стереоусилитель на tda2822m


Прошивка LM723 блок питания контроллера Atmega168 - Стереоусилитель на tda2822m Вы Источники электропитания не можете скачивать файлы с Стереоусилитель на tda2822m нашего Стереоусилитель на tda2822m сервера

Блок Розетка с дистанционным управлением купить питания можно использовать от Фото реле vito phs01 схема подключения зарядного устройства Стереоусилитель на tda2822m для мобильного телефона LM723 блок питания или можно Источники электропитания воспользоватся такими Стереоусилитель на tda2822m схемами:
Стереоусилитель на tda2822m
Стереоусилитель на tda2822m
Стереоусилитель на tda2822m
Стереоусилитель на tda2822m